Output 8fdd61a2db89e4a3378bebedbee10c8c6217c3e81e9595e7ce990435bf0c8d7e:2

value
381566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190c9980d464aa61b973228762deefc877af43ae OP_EQUAL
address
33yTumzjmukDCnMKNnExidTdwyUgQF3igr
transaction
8fdd61a2db89e4a3378bebedbee10c8c6217c3e81e9595e7ce990435bf0c8d7e
confirmations
7831
spent
false